In this powerful episode of the Immunity Group Australia Podcast, Nina speaks with Amanda R. DeSio Whitehouse, PhD, a licensed psychologist, food-allergy mother, speaker, podcast host, and author of the newly launched book From Fear to Freedom. A Workbook for Navigating Allergy Immunotherapy. Amanda shares a deeply personal and professional perspective on the emotional reality of living with food allergy, from anxiety, trauma and hypervigilance to the hope and complexity of allergy immunotherapy. Together, we explore why food allergy anxiety is not “irrational,” how families can process fear with compassion, why psychological support should sit alongside medical treatment, and what life can look like after treatment, maintenance and graduation. This is an essential conversation for parents, carers, clinicians and anyone seeking to understand the journey from survival mode to confidence, safety and freedom.
